IELTS Test Format
The test is used in 2 versions: IELTS Academic and IELTS General Training. Both variations share the exact same listening and speaking sections, but the reading and writing jobs differ to reflect the functions of each track.

5. Sharpen Time Management
- In the reading section, invest roughly 20 minutes per passage, then move on.
- In writing, designate 20 minutes to Task 1 and 40 minutes to Task 2, leaving 5 minutes for checking.
6. Reinforce Listening Skills
- Listen to numerous English accents (British, Australian, American) through podcasts, news broadcasts, and films.
- Practice "forecasting" responses before the recording plays; this enhances focus.

3. What is the difference in between "Computer‑Delivered IELTS" and "Paper‑Based IELTS"?
Both versions have similar content and scoring. Computer‑delivered deals much faster outcomes (usually 3‑5 days) and more versatile scheduling, while paper‑based remains familiar to those who choose composing by hand.
4. Do I need to take both Academic and General Training?
No. Pick the version that matches your goal. Most university candidates take Academic; those making an application for immigration or work normally take General Training.
